Xi Jinping Calls for Unity Ahead of Spring Festival with Non-CPC Leaders

Beijing, January 25, 2025 — In a gesture of unity and collaboration, Xi Jinping, General Secretary of the Communist Party of China (CPC) Central Committee, extended festive greetings to non-CPC political parties, the All-China Federation of Industry and Commerce (ACFIC), personages without party affiliation, and other members of the united front ahead of the Spring Festival.

During an annual gathering held at the Great Hall of the People in Beijing, Xi, who is also the Chinese President and Chairman of the Central Military Commission, conveyed his best wishes for the upcoming Lunar New Year, which falls on January 29 this year.

Addressing the assembled leaders and representatives, Xi emphasized China's commitment to implementing more proactive and impactful macroeconomic policies in the coming year. He underscored the focus on high-quality development and the promotion of greater self-reliance and strength in science and technology to sustain the nation's social and economic progress in 2025.

"We must work together to achieve the targets set in the 14th Five-Year Plan and lay a solid foundation for the next five years," Xi stated. He called upon the non-CPC political parties, the ACFIC, and personages without party affiliation to leverage their unique strengths, rally broader support, and pool wisdom and resources to serve the country's overall interests.

Xi highlighted the importance of mobilizing all positive forces to advance development. He encouraged contributions toward comprehensively deepening reform, promoting high-quality development, and formulating proposals for the upcoming 15th Five-Year Plan (2026–2030).

Environmental protection was also a key topic, as Xi stressed the need to address critical and challenging problems in supervising the protection of the Yangtze River ecosystem. He urged concerted efforts to safeguard this vital natural resource.

Speaking directly to the ACFIC, Xi urged the organization to guide the private sector in maintaining enthusiasm for entrepreneurship and bolstering confidence in development. He emphasized the importance of establishing and improving modern corporate systems with distinctive Chinese features.
